Importance of a Official Agent
A registered agent plays a crucial role in the operation of a company, acting as the designated point of contact for law-related and government documents. This responsibility ensures that companies receive important correspondence such as tax documents, court summons, and compliance-related paperwork in a timely manner. Without a appointed registered agent, a firm risks failing to receive critical communications that could lead to litigation or infractions with state regulations.
Furthermore, a registered agent improves a firm's confidentiality and protection. By using a registered agent company, business proprietors can avoid having their individual details, such as personal addresses, listed on official records. This not only protects privacy but also minimizes the risk of spam and potential risk from unwanted contact. The comfort that comes with knowing that private information is handled professionally is essential.
Finally, having a registered agent ensures that a business remains compliant with state requirements. Each state has distinct legal obligations regarding registered agents, including the mandate to maintain a physical presence in the state of incorporation. Meeting these obligations is crucial to maintaining compliance and avoiding penalties. By hiring a dedicated registered agent provider, companies can focus on their activities while ensuring that compliance responsibilities are fully satisfied.

Adherence and Legal Obligations
A designated agent is vital for guaranteeing that a company remains compliant with state laws. Each state necessitates that businesses, whether they are limited liability companies or corporate entities, appoint a designated agent to receive important legal notices. This includes service of process, tax notifications, and regulatory correspondence. Inability to maintain a registered agent can result in penalties, such as financial penalties or loss of good standing, making it essential for business owners to comprehend these legal requirements.
When picking a registered agent service, it is crucial to consider their familiarity of local legislation and regulations. A trustworthy registered agent will help confirm that your business meets all statutory requirements, thus shielding you against potential legal challenges.
